I work for a furniture company that essentially purchased another furniture store some time back a few years ago.
However, this furniture store that was acquired had a website. The website has no existing pages anymore, only the homepage. The homepage has a message on it describing how it's been taken over and then links to our website.
The spam score for the website is 8. I was wondering if there was something else we should do instead of the link, whether that be a straight 301 redirect or if we should have the link at all considering its score.

Just doing a quick test in Opensite explorer it would appear that http://www.scadgells.co.uk has a couple of external backlinks links from a website called furniturebuyer.info, where as http://scadgell.co.uk has no backlinks. The links are from a relevant source, but doubt will provide you with a huge boost.
If you can access OSE, I would suggest looking at the following link for the www. domain too just incase there are a few more elements.
https://moz.com/researchtools/ose/pages?site=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.scadgells.co.uk As well as the backlinks it also appears to show a possible 7 indexed pages which you may want to redirect or even 404 depending on what they were originally about. None of the pages deeper than the homepage appear to have any backlinks.Hope that also helps.

You'll want to do a risk assessment of the domain before set up 301-redirects to your site. Set it up in Google Search Console if you haven't already. Check for any manual actions or malware warnings associated with the site. Then you'll want to audit the backlinks to check for any problems there.
If you can share the link with the community, someone else might find issues that you don't see.
I suspect the spam score would be lower if the site was more than one page. Right now, it probably seems like a doorway page since it's just one page that links to another site.
